Understanding Diet and Nutrition What is a Diet? A diet refers to the collection of foods and beverages a person consumes regularly. In scientific and medical contexts, the term has a more specific meaning: it describes the overall pattern of nutrient intake that supplies the energy and building materials your body needs for growth, repair, and daily functioning. This is different from the popular use of the word "diet" to mean a restrictive eating plan—we're studying diet as your normal eating pattern and how it affects your health. Macronutrients: The Energy Providers Your body requires three main macronutrients—nutrients needed in large quantities—that together provide the calories (energy) your body uses every day. Each plays a distinct and vital role: Carbohydrates are your body's preferred fuel source, especially for your brain and muscles. When you eat carbohydrates (found in grains, fruits, vegetables, and legumes), your digestive system breaks them down into glucose, which cells use immediately for energy or store for later use. This is why athletes often "carb-load" before competition—they're ensuring plenty of fuel is available. Proteins serve as the building blocks for nearly every structure in your body. Dietary proteins are broken down into amino acids, which your cells use to build and repair tissues, create enzymes (which speed up chemical reactions), and synthesize hormones (chemical messengers that regulate body processes). You find proteins in meat, fish, eggs, dairy products, legumes, nuts, and seeds. Fats are energy-dense molecules that play multiple critical roles. Beyond providing concentrated energy (more than twice the calories per gram compared to carbohydrates or proteins), fats are essential for building cell membranes, producing hormones, and enabling the absorption of fat-soluble vitamins (vitamins A, D, E, and K). Without dietary fat, your body cannot absorb these important vitamins even if you consume them. Micronutrients and Water: The Essential Helpers While macronutrients provide energy and structure, micronutrients—vitamins and minerals—are required in much smaller amounts but are equally essential for survival. These nutrients don't provide calories, but they serve as cofactors and coenzymes, meaning they help drive the thousands of chemical reactions happening in your cells every second. Key roles of micronutrients include: Supporting metabolic pathways (the chemical sequences that extract energy from food and build new molecules) Strengthening your immune system to fight infections Maintaining bone health and structure Supporting vision, nerve function, and blood clotting Examples include iron (needed for oxygen transport in blood), calcium (for bone structure and muscle contraction), vitamin C (for immune function and collagen formation), and iodine (for thyroid hormone production). Water deserves special mention as a critical nutrient. It's the medium in which all life processes occur—it acts as a solvent for minerals and vitamins, carries nutrients to cells and waste away from cells, regulates body temperature through sweating, and cushions joints. You lose water constantly through breathing, sweating, and urine, so adequate daily water intake is fundamental to health. Principles of a Balanced and Healthy Diet A balanced diet (also called a healthy diet) provides all the essential nutrients your body needs in the right proportions while avoiding harmful excesses. The challenge is that no single food contains all necessary nutrients—different foods provide different nutrient profiles. This is why nutrition science emphasizes three core principles: Variety means consuming a wide range of different foods. Since no single food is nutritionally complete, eating diverse foods ensures you receive all vitamins, minerals, and other beneficial compounds. A tomato provides lycopene and vitamin C but not vitamin B12; eggs provide B12 and choline but less vitamin C. Together, diverse foods create nutritional completeness. Proportionality refers to the amounts and ratios of different food groups on your plate. A well-proportioned diet emphasizes foods in their natural, minimally processed form: fruits, vegetables, whole grains, and legumes should fill most of your plate. Animal proteins, high-fat foods, added sugars, salt, and saturated fats are included in smaller, controlled amounts. The reasoning is straightforward: nutrient-dense foods (those with many nutrients per calorie) should dominate, while calorie-dense foods with few nutrients should be limited. Adequacy means consuming enough total calories to match your energy expenditure, maintaining a healthy body weight. If you consume significantly more calories than you burn, excess energy is stored as fat tissue. If you consume too few calories, your body breaks down muscle and organ tissue for energy. True health requires the right amount of food—not too little, not too much. <extrainfo> Why Diet Matters: Broader Health and Social Implications Your dietary choices extend beyond personal health. Poor dietary patterns contribute to obesity, type 2 diabetes, cardiovascular disease, and certain cancers—some of the most significant public health challenges in developed nations. At a societal level, diet intersects with food security (whether all people have reliable access to adequate nutrition) and environmental sustainability (whether current food production can be maintained long-term). These connections between individual eating choices and population-wide health outcomes represent an important frontier in public health. </extrainfo>
